Ingredients

For the Pie Crust

  • 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, chilled and diced
  • 3 tablespoons ice water

For the Filling

  • 1 cup corn syrup
  • 1 cup br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 4 large eggs
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 2 cups pecans, chopped
  • 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

Make sure to gather all your ingredients before starting for a smooth preparation process.

Instructions

Prepare the Pie Crust

In a mixing bowl, combine the flour and salt. Add the diced butter and mix until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Stir in the ice water, a tablespoon at a time, until the dough comes together.

Shape the dough into a disk, wrap it in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.

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).

Roll Out the Dough

On a floured surface, roll out the chilled dough into a circle about 1/8 inch thick. Transfer it to a 9-inch pie pan, trim the excess, and crimp the edges.

Make the Filling

In a large bowl, whisk together the corn syrup, brown sugar, cocoa powder, eggs, and vanilla. Stir in the chopped pecans and chocolate chips.

Assemble and Bake

Pour the filling into the prepared pie crust and bake for 50 minutes, or until the filling is set. Let it cool before serving.

Tips for Perfecting Your Pie

To achieve the perfect pie crust, ensure that your butter is well-chilled. This helps create a flaky texture that complements the rich filling. When mixing the dough, avoid overworking it; you want the butter to remain in small chunks for the best results.

For the filling, using fresh, high-quality ingredients is key. Opt for pure vanilla extract rather than imitation for a deeper flavor. Additionally, to enhance the chocolate taste, consider using dark chocolate chips instead of semi-sweet for a more intense chocolate experience.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I make this pie in advance?

Yes! You can prepare the pie a day ahead and store it in the refrigerator.

→ What can I substitute for corn syrup?

You can use maple syrup or honey as a substitute for corn syrup.

→ Can I use other nuts instead of pecans?

Yes, walnuts or almonds can be used as alternatives, but they will change the flavor profile.

→ How should I store leftovers?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
